LINUX.ORG.RU

Кармак: Linux не оправдывает надежд

 ,


0

2

Как всем хорошо известно, Valve заявила о выходе на игровой Linux рынок. Этот шаг прокомментировал один из сооснователей id Software на конференции «QuakeCon 2012». Он отметил, что его компания работает на этом рынке достаточно долго, однако не видит положительного результата. Разработка под Linux кроме одобрения Linux сообщества ничего не приносит. Как следствие, Rage и Doom 4 скорее всего не выйдут на Linux.

Напомню, что id Software известно не только тем, что ее игры doom и quake идут нативно под Linux. Также это компания неоднократно открывала Linux сообществу свои исходники.

http://www.pcper.com/reviews/Editorial/John-Carmacks-QuakeCon-2012-Keynote

★★★★

Проверено: DoctorSinus ()
Последнее исправление: DoctorSinus (всего исправлений: 4)

Ответ на: комментарий от mylorlogin

В любом случае Кармак молодец
чем же плоха финансовая сторона?

dormeur86 ★★★★
()
Ответ на: комментарий от pashazz

Я бы не сказал, что будет легко. IdTech3 был сильно модифицирован. Конечно, я исходники не видел, да и профессионализма, сделать адекватное заключение по исходникам мне не хватит. Но рендеринг подвергся очень сильной доработке, в частности пост-рендеринг (отражения, динамические и мягкие тени, освещение), добавлена своя собственная система скелетной анимации, которая а оригинальном IdTech3 отсутствовала, хотя и поддерживала сторонние решения. В следующих версиях игр серии движок подвергался еще более сильным модификациям, к примеру в движке был заменен с OpenGL на DirectX. И не видя исходников, очень сложно сказать, каким именно способом были реализованы данные изменения. Очень может статься, что портирование не закончится простой пересборкой под новую платформу, но придется очень серьезно дорабатывать движок. А это уже ресурсы.

В частности те же Valve. Source так же является потомком GldSource, который в свою очередь является потомком QuakeTech с элементами IdTech2 с добавленной скелетной анимацией. И Valve так же в GldSource добавили рендеринг посредством DirecX, а в Source и вовсе убрали (за ненадобностью), а теперь вот возвращают все «взад» (хотя они все вернули еще при портировании на OSX). Но все же это ресурсы компании, человекочасы, которые стоят немало баблища, и эти человекочасы можно потратить на другие направления. Именно из-за этого Id не хочет связываться с портами для Linux. И именно из-за этого это делает Valve вкладывая свои ресуры в долгосрочные инвестиции в Linux. Скорее всего затраты Valve не окупятся сразу, но возможно принесут дивиденды в будущем. В любом случае это риск. Но Valve решили рискнуть, а Id нет. Скачем так - Id рисковала в прошлом, и их риск не оправдался. Но у них и ситуация была иная - они выходили на Linux каждый раз с одной игрой, а Valve туда собирается придти с целой инфраструктурой.

В свете нынешних событий мне очень интересна судьба Desura. Что будет с ними? Они пришли на рынок Linux, свободный от конкурентов, а теперь самый главный и самый сильный конкурент идет вслед за ними. Не удивлюсь. если вслед за Steam туда пойдут и Origin.

ivanlex ★★★★★
()
Ответ на: комментарий от f1xmAn

Поделись своим костылем. А то траблы со звуком уже достали. Кстати, кто в курсе, идет ли развитие IoDoom3? Они хотя бы известные ошибки профиксят?

ivanlex ★★★★★
()
Ответ на: комментарий от pashazz

Suorce от Valve тоже идет на OSX, но для того, что бы он заработал на Linux все равно им пришлось движок серьезно дорабатывать. MacOSX хоть и POSIX, но все же не линукс. К примеру там нет Иксов. Вернее есть, но рендеринг игр идет не через него. OpenGL? Замечательно, но вывод на экран идет совсем по другому, поэтому все равно приходиться рихтовать движок напильником, а это уже серьезная доработка, и на это потребуется тратить ресурсы компании. А компании коммерческие, там нет добровольцев, все работают за зарплату, а не ради удовольствия. Вряд ли другие компании будут заниматься портированием, если не увидят в этом прямой выгоды. Затраты должны окупаться! Это правило бизнеса, и те компании, которые эти правила не соблюдают - прогорают. Это закон экономики, и никуда от этого не деться. Valve может себе позволить такой риск - у них хорошая экономическая подушка, и если риск не окупиться, они могут себе позволить забыть о неудачи. Но эта неудача станет ярким примером для других компаний, и можно будет похоронить Линукс на десктопах, а M$ воцаряться на них безраздельно. Если Valve будут иметь успех на новом рынке - это так же заставит другие компании задуматься, и возможно именно тогда, они решат все же рискнуть и потратить ресурсы на портирование своих игр на новую для них платформу. Сейчас мы наблюдаем переходный момент.

А Кармак... я его глубоко уважаю как гениального программиста, но для него ПК - это не целевая аудитория.

ivanlex ★★★★★
()
Ответ на: комментарий от beresk_let

Всегда приятно похихикать над двусмысленными фразами. Они оставляют поле для внезапных трактовок и превратных толкований :)

slackwarrior ★★★★★
()

Разработка под Linux кроме одобрения Linux сообщества ничего не приносит.

гыгыгыгыгыг :) Вы извините, но Линукс - это FOSS, что ещё вы хотели получить? Крики о популярности Линукса - просто шум. Он слишком специфичен, чтобы быть десктоп инструментом каждой домохозяйки. Ubuntu тому пример - хоть обвешай обоями весь экран, система объективно всё равно сложная. С трудом представляю себе этих ср** маркетологов, до которых только сейчас дошла ущербность идеи игр под Линукс.

matumba ★★★★★
()
Последнее исправление: matumba (всего исправлений: 1)
Ответ на: комментарий от matumba

> Ubuntu тому пример - хоть обвешай обоями весь экран, система объективно всё равно сложная.

Ubuntu не линукс.

Линукс - быстрая и стабильная в работе система. Ubuntu - глючный глюкодром, занимающий больше ресурсов компьютера, чем шиндовс виста, а линукс с тем же самым Gnome 2, что и в убунте, не глючит и не тормозит. И тому есть объяснения: в Canonical ничего полезного для Linux не делают, там в основном только маркетологи. Там выпускают релиз дистрибутива точно в срок, фактически выпуская альфа-версию. И ни разу не отложили релиз чтобы исправить баги, что обычная практика для многих популярных дистрибутивов Linux.

Все эти разговоры про «они сделали первый не-красноглазый Linux, который стало можно советовать новичкам в Linux» - полнейший бред. Mandrake и SUSE образца 2004 года уделывают Ubuntu 2012-го по всем параметрам! Кроме того, в них уже тогда был фирменный комплект программ для администратора, работающий как из графической оболочки, так и из псевдографики, что делает установку и настройку системы и удобной для новичков, и приятной для специалиста. А в canonical до сих пор только и делают что пиарятся в новостях бессодержательными новостями.

И это привязка к Интернету... Я конечно понимаю - фирменная черта дистрибутива, что без Интернета использовать нельзя (кроме как сделать копию репозитория на HDD или 8 DVD), но ведь после этого на форумах объясняют, что Linux - это такая пускалка браузера и система для Интернета, но никак не для работы.

Ни за что бы не советовал Ubuntu как систему для новичков. Чем бы она ни позиционировалась, это система для продвинутых пользователей Linux, которые разбираются в нём хотя бы немного. Новичок, установивший Ubuntu Linux из любопытства, снесёт с HDD эту глючную и тормозную поделку и не захочет возвращаться в этот глючный Linux. Поэтому Ubuntu и не Linux: в ней нет никаких положительных качеств линукса, кроме отсутствия вирусов.

ZenitharChampion ★★★★★
()
Ответ на: комментарий от ZenitharChampion

Ну все же как толсто ты тролишь. Все твои посты сводятся к тому, что: «Я не знаю что здесь обсуждают, но Ubuntu - гавно, а SuSe - настоящий линукс». И это пишет человек который не осилил элементарную настройку Самбы... Бяда-бяда огорчение... Но от твоих неуместных высеров Ubuntu все равно остается Линуксом, и нынешний SuSe по глючности не уступает ему, и так же требует интернета, для установки дополнительный и сторонних компонентов. Попробуй на тот же SuSe поставить кодеки без интернета?! Репозитории никуда не делись. Кончай тролить, хотя бы пытайся рассуждать адекватно.

ivanlex ★★★★★
()
Ответ на: комментарий от ivanlex

> Ну все же как толсто ты тролишь. Все твои посты сводятся к тому, что: «Я не знаю что здесь обсуждают, но Ubuntu - гавно, а SuSe - настоящий линукс».

Я не агитирую за openSUSE. Просто я установил именно его. А хороших дистрибутивов Linux много, даже малопопулярные дистрибутивы Linux часто удобнее Ubuntu просто потому что их делают люди с прямыми руками.

> Но от твоих неуместных высеров Ubuntu все равно остается Линуксом, и нынешний SuSe по глючности не уступает ему, и так же требует интернета, для установки дополнительный и сторонних компонентов.

Кодеки и видеодрайвер. Всё. Если очень нужно работать, а не играть или крутить кубик компиза, всё для работы есть сразу, на установочном DVD.

> Попробуй на тот же SuSe поставить кодеки без интернета?!

Эти жалкие 20 Мб можно сходить и скачать у соседа. С Ubuntu потребуются сотни мегабайт программ для того чтобы хотя бы начать работать.

Я чего-то не понимаю, или ты сам недавно говорил, что «Linux не готов для десктопа, и мы видим это на примере Ubuntu»?

ZenitharChampion ★★★★★
()
Ответ на: комментарий от wq

>> Кармак: Linux не оправдывает надежд

> Как будто Кармак оправдывает.

Первая OpenGL-игра для Linux, Quake 2. Крупное пожертвование проекту Mesa в 2000 году. Выпуск первой демо-версии Quake III Arena только для Linux в расчёте на то, что пользователей хоть и меньше, но среди них полно компетентных людей. И они оправдались: нашлось несколько трудноуловимых багов. Вторая демо-версия вышла для Mac OS X, третья - для Windows. А потом - релиз.

ZenitharChampion ★★★★★
()
Ответ на: комментарий от ivanlex

У меня уже ни дума, ни костыля. Но могу посоветовать пускать звук в обход пульсаудио, емнип, я так и делал.

f1xmAn ★★★★★
()

Да всё верно говорит. У Линукса 1% десктопов, при этом 95% пользователей гики, которые платить деньги не будут. В итоге 0.05% не стоят затраченных усилий.

alpha4
()
Ответ на: комментарий от ZenitharChampion

Ubuntu не линукс.

А OpenWRT - Linux?

Canonical ничего полезного для Linux не делают

Я вам уже приводил ссылку, по которой вы лично согласились с тем, что это ваше утвержедние ложно. Скажите, пожалуйста, почему вы противоречите себе? Это выглядит крайне странно со стороны.

RussianNeuroMancer ★★★★★
()

больше не будет игор от этой конторки под лайнакс потомучто а) эта конторка продалась и кармак уже ничего не решает б)того парня который портировал игры на лайнакс погнали в шею в)они теперь делают игры для консолей нового поколения а портов с соснолей на лайнакс как известно не бувает --- только на виндос

anonymous
()
Ответ на: комментарий от RussianNeuroMancer

Чем больше фактов тролю приводишь, тем больше он тролит. Я уже устал жир с монитора стирать, как жирно он это делает. Ну ни видит человек дальше своего носа и не помнит своих прошлых слов и ошибок. Уперся он в свой Yast и Open SuSe и видеть больше ничего не хочет. Только и твердит всем вокруг одно и то же, хотя не раз уже был тыкан что не прав...

ivanlex ★★★★★
()
Ответ на: комментарий от ZenitharChampion

Я не агитирую за openSUSE. Просто я установил именно его.

Я не агитирую за Ubuntu, но когда Вы полный бред несете, каверкая факты, и дергая слова из контекста, поливая дистрибутив помоями, не имея своего субъективного мнения... Я не фанат Ubuntu и на работе мне пришлось испробовать множество разнейших дистрибутивов. Какие то хороши для одних задач, какие то для других. Но все дистрибутивы отличаются друг от друга набором ПО из коробки после установки. Так можно сделать из Debian ту же Ubuntu, но Debian Вы за Линукс признаете, а Ubuntu - нет. У Вас двойные стандарты.

Эти жалкие 20 Мб можно сходить и скачать у соседа.

Мне для моей работы нужно будет скачать не 20 МБ, а сотни, и мне без разницы с какого дистрибутива их качать. Если человеку достаточно ПО, который есть на DVD, то этот компьютер и правда только как пускалка браузера годиться. Я еще не одного человека не встречал, который был бы удовлетворен только поставляемым с дистрибутивом ПО.

Вы недавно называли Ubuntu не Линуксом, смеясь, говоря, что наконец то Unity портировали с Ubuntu на Линукс. Хочу Вам напомнить, что пару лет назад все точно так же ржали над Yast, говоря, что его наконец то портировали с SuSe на Линукс.

Относитесь терпимее к другим дистрибутивам, или Вас реально так зависть душит, что Вам приходиться сидеть на SuSe?!

P.S. И кстати, практически все конфиги, практически во всех дистрибутивах, лежат в одном и том же мести, поэтому Yast не нужен. И я Вам соболезную...

ivanlex ★★★★★
()
Ответ на: комментарий от f1xmAn

Я так и сам делал, но я думал, что вдруг есть нормальный патч. который исправляет саму суть проблемы...

ivanlex ★★★★★
()
Ответ на: комментарий от ivanlex

ну, Desura будет второсортным стимом для тех, кто в этот стим не попал.

pashazz ★★★★
()
Ответ на: комментарий от pashazz

Частично. На deb дистрибутивах все равно не пахает, хотя энтузиастам и удавалось его запустить, но и только. Но сейчас прилетит ZenitharChampion и начнет объяснять, что это потому, что deb-дистрибутивы - не линукс.

ivanlex ★★★★★
()
Ответ на: комментарий от f1xmAn

Ага, только они пока отмалчиваются. Еще не одного релиза IoDoom3 не выпустили. Пока ждем продвижения в их работе. Пусть парням способствует удача!

ivanlex ★★★★★
()
Ответ на: комментарий от anon000

и чем же они «безопаснее» смены значения одной переменной?

xtraeft ★★☆☆
()
Ответ на: комментарий от ZenitharChampion

Ты, наверное, каждую тему грепаешь по слову Ubuntu, чтобы выплеснуть свою желчь? Запишись уже к психологу наконец.

bloodredfrog ★★
()
Ответ на: комментарий от Oleaster

Я великолепен, ага. Даже знаю, что запятая между подлежащим и сказуемым не ставится. Но не горюй: у тебя ещё большое (как выражается Минсоцэкономразвития) время доживания, авось и ты сподобишься что-нибудь узнать полезное.

Здесь школьный дух. Здесь сливом пахнет.

e000xf000h
()
Ответ на: комментарий от alpha4

при этом 95% пользователей гики, которые платить деньги не будут

Бред какой. Как раз таки и гики платят нехило. Man статистика humble bundle по платформам.

resurtm ★★★
()
Ответ на: комментарий от xtraeft

Не местные, не игровый, да и не эксперты. Но такое предположение я осмелился сделать, руководствуясь тем, что EA уже проник в Линукс, продвигая свои браузерки через Ubuntu.

ivanlex ★★★★★
()
Ответ на: комментарий от beresk_let

Авокадо^W Автокад ещё.

имхо, автокад сам автодеск уже мечтает в утиль списать. параметризации нет, да и вообще устаревшая концепция. autodesk Inventor годный

И Zbrush бы еще

браш конечно вещь. но пока не портировали, можно autodesk mudbox для лепки юзать. версия под линух есть

anonymous
()

Linux: Кармак не оправдывает надежд

Исправлено.

AVL2 ★★★★★
()
Ответ на: комментарий от xtraeft

HL3

ну это только одна игра. да и то, даже hl2ep3 не вышел еще.

Эти эпизоды к HL 2 и есть HL3:

http://en.wikipedia.org/wiki/Half-Life_2#Sequels

In an interview with Eurogamer, Gabe Newell revealed that the Half-Life 2 «episodes» are essentially Half-Life 3.

http://www.eurogamer.net/articles/i_valve_060606

Gabe Newell:
Probably a better name for it would have been Half Life 3: Episode One, but these three are what we're doing as our way of taking the next step forward, but Half-Life 2 was the name we used. ...

<поскипано>

Half-Life 3 [a.k.a. Episodes One to Three] is about ...

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.